McDonald India Invests Rs 14cr To Start 3.2MW Solar Plant In Delhi

Leading fast food chain McDonald’s India (North and East) has invested Rs 14 crore to commission Delhi’s largest solar power plant in Najafgarh. Angola Secures €1.29 Billion Loan for Renewable Mini-Grids and Grid Expansion

Angola’s Ministry of Finance has secured a loan of €1.29 billion ($1.41 billion) through the assistance of Standard Chartered Bank, UK. This funding will be utilized to implement 48 solar photovoltaic (PV) and energy storage mini-grids across various rural areas across Angola.
